The Joy of Collecting Shells

Walking on the beach, hearing the waves and feeling the sand, I love searching for shells to make beautiful necklaces. Each shell tells a story and is like a piece of art made by nature.

Picking the Best Shells

I gather different shells and check them for nice colors, smooth textures, and cool shapes. I think about how they will fit into a necklace and add their own special touch. Planning the Necklace

After collecting a bunch of shells, I lay them out and think about how to arrange them to make a pretty necklace. I think about their size, shape, and colors until I find the perfect design.

Putting the Shells on a Thread

Once I decide on the arrangement, I carefully put each shell on a strong thread. It takes time and focus to make sure the necklace is not only pretty but also strong. I enjoy the calm feeling of creating something beautiful.

Making It Perfect

After putting all the shells on the thread, I finish the necklace by adding a clasp and any extra decorations. It feels good to know I turned a bunch of shells into a beautiful necklace.

Sharing the Beauty

When the necklace is done, I feel happy to show it to other people. It brings me joy to see them smile while they look at the necklace and know that the beauty of the shells can be enjoyed by others.
